As a kid, I would put … Web1 mei 2024 · Then, the tradition is to set down your treats on the doorstep, ring the doorbell, and run away before you’re caught. If you’re a child who receives a May Day basket, historically, the tradition was to chase after the giver until you caught them and kissed them. My kids view this possibility with terror, and typically run their hearts out ...

Web25 apr. 2024 · May Baskets. The tradition of the May basket is a way of welcoming spring and celebrating companionship that is sadly passing from cultural memory in contemporary society. In the U.S., the custom had its heyday in the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ries, and while it has held on in some rural areas of the country, it was mostly ...
